📑 Table of Contents
On/off states of GTK's toggle switch widget

A toggle switch is a graphical control element that allows the user to make a choice between two mutually exclusive states (such as on/off). Originally toggle switches were used primary in touchscreen-based user interfaces, but they have later become commonplace in desktop and web applications.

Toggle switches have a similar function as checkboxes, but unlike checkboxes, interacting with a toggle switch usually has an immediate effect on the application or system.[1]

Usability

edit
An animated toggle switch widget, demonstrating the ambiguous state problem

Early research on touchscreen interfaces has identified usability issues with toggle switches.[2] A common problem is ambiguous state indication: For example, does the label "on" indicate the current state of the switch or the resulting state after interacting with it?

Communicating affordance can also be difficult: for example should the user tap or slide the switch to change its state.

References

edit
  1. ^ "Toggle switches". 2017-05-19. Retrieved 2020-12-23.
  2. ^ Plaisant, Catherine; Wallace, Daniel (November 1990). Touchscreen toggle switches: push or slide? Design issues and usability study (PDF) (Report). Human-Computer Interaction Laboratory, University of Maryland. Retrieved 2020-12-24.
edit
  • Wikimedia Commons logo Media related to Toggle switches (GUI) at Wikimedia Commons

📚 Artikel Terkait di Wikipedia

Checkbox

CHECK U+2612 ☒ BALLOT BOX WITH X Tick-box culture Radio button Toggle switch (widget) Boolean data type "Check Boxes". msdn. Retrieved February 5, 2010

Graphical widget

In a graphical user interface (GUI), a graphical widget (also graphical control element or control) is an element of interaction, such as a button or a

Table of keyboard shortcuts

Shortcuts > Full Keyboard Access > All Controls Alternatively use Ctrl+F7 to toggle this setting. Alt+⇧ Shift changes between languages while Ctrl+⇧ Shift changes

IOS 16

screen. The date is now above the time and a small widget can be added next to the date. Other widgets can be added and arranged horizontally on the third

Button (computing)

than once to receive the desired result. Other buttons are designed to toggle behavior on and off like a check box. These buttons will show a graphical

Windows shell

Settings, while ⊞ Win+N opens the notification center. Widgets: Windows 11 introduced a "Widgets" feature which replaces the functionality of live tiles

NeWS

communications to an outside program (or more NeWS code) when the widget demanded it. For example, a toggle button's display routine can query the button's state

Windows key

⊞ Win+Space bar activates Aero Peek. Reassigned in Windows 8. ⊞ Win+P toggles between the devices that receive video card's output. The default is computer